Output ad76f5eb75bd1d0c6442846d8ef783b6d7a8afe364e2975cc1abb0e4e2428991:3

value
704000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91f7c209f515cefb1f9e27f05325554bb145ef3f OP_EQUAL
address
3EzphtF81a29Gic2NKQRFCYpVctQuaRrJf
transaction
ad76f5eb75bd1d0c6442846d8ef783b6d7a8afe364e2975cc1abb0e4e2428991
spent
true